I especially liked the small room with an old-fasHillwood was the home of Marjorie Merriweather Post, a pioneering businesswoman, engaged citizen, generous philanthropist, and distinguished collector. As the heir to the Postum Cereal Company, later General Foods, Marjorie (1887-1973) was among the wealthiest women of her time. Hillwood is known for Post’s large decorative arts collection from imperial Russia as well as cultivated orchids. …Russian Porcelain. The largest single category of Hillwood’s Russian holdings is porcelain. Already collecting 18 th -century Sèvres porcelain both for display and for dining, Post discovered the bright colors and lively designs of Russian porcelain when she lived in Moscow and collected many pieces and sets over the rest of her long life. The French parterre—a formal garden with low intricate plantings divided by footpaths and surrounded by walls of English ivy—is designed to capture the feel of a small formal garden of the eighteenth century. Echoing the classical symmetry and geometry typical of French garden design, the parterre is divided into four sections using gravel ... Hillwood’s horticulturists and floral designers often create modern-day variations of arrangements based on photographs of the floral designs found in the rooms during Post’s years at Hillwood. The dining room table is always set with Post's elegant services. Marjorie Post entertains students in the dining room in 1964.
